Output 52526226fc2386caea867299a24516209521013326b2a6c5c1d8b00b9d79f47a:1

value
36051200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ab8cea4aa071c7e9c1a8f494d1e7f4ade04116a9 OP_EQUAL
address
3HL6HJjbfmoZRnXTw3cWX8iPDiPqSvS2Xg
transaction
52526226fc2386caea867299a24516209521013326b2a6c5c1d8b00b9d79f47a
spent
true